The Global Tower Internals Market pertains to a crucial aspect of industrial infrastructure, focusing on the internal components and structures within industrial towers. Tower internals play a fundamental role in various industrial processes, particularly in sectors such as oil and gas, petrochemicals, chemical processing, power generation, and water treatment. These components are designed to optimize the efficiency, performance, and safety of tower operations by facilitating fluid separation, mass transfer, heat exchange, and other essential processes. Tower internals encompass a diverse range of equipment, including trays, packings, distributors, demisters, mist eliminators, support grids, and other specialized components tailored to specific applications and operating conditions.
